• Tidak ada hasil yang ditemukan

Komponen Microsoft Visual Basic 6

LANDASAN TEOR

2.3 Microsoft Visual Basic

2.3.2 Komponen Microsoft Visual Basic 6

Bahasa pemrograman Visual Basic 6.0 merupakan bahasa pemrograman yang sangat mudah dipelajari, dengan teknik pemrograman visual yang memungkinkan penggunanya untuk berkreasi lebih baik dalam menghasilkan suatu program aplikasi. Adapun lingkungan jendela utama Microsoft Visual Basic 6.0 mengandung banyak sarana yang dibutuhkan penggunanya untuk membangun program-program untuk versi Windows dengan cepat dan efisien. Berikut ini adalah gambar interface antar muka Visual Basic 6.0 :

Seperti yang terlihat pada gambar 2.1 diatas, layar kerja Microsoft Visual Basic 6.0 itu sendiri terdiri atas beberapa komponen dasar yaitu :

1. Title Bar, merupakan batang menu dari program Visual Basic 6.0 yang terletak pada bagian paling atas jendela program, digunakan untuk melakukan manipulasi jendela atau layar Visual Basic serta menampilkan judul atau nama jendela. Pada title bar ini dapat melakukan perubahan ukuran, pemindahan jendela atau menutup jendela yang aktif. Tampilan

title bar dapat dilihat pada gambar 2.2.

Gambar 2.2Title Bar Microsoft Visual Basic 6.0

2. Menu Bar, merupakan batang menu yang terletak di bawah title bar yang berfungsi untuk menampilkan pilihan menu atau perintah untuk mengoperasikan program Visual Basic. Menu bar dalam VB seperti yang biasa kita lihat dalam Microsoft Office. Di dalamnya terdapat menu File,

Edit, View, Project, Format dan sejenisnya. Tampilan Menu Bar dapat dilihat pada gambar 2.3.

Gambar 2.3Menu Bar Microsoft Visual Basic 6.0

3. Toolbar, merupakan sebuah batang yang berisi kumpulan tombol yang terletak di bagian bawah menu bar yang dapat digunakan untuk menjalankan suatu perintah. Pada kondisi default program Visual Basic hanya menampilkan toolbar Standart. Toolbar berisi ikon-ikon yang

fungsinya sama dengan menu, tetapi dapat digunakan dengan lebih cepat karena sebuah ikon mewakili satu perintah tertentu. Contohnya adalah ikon Open, Save, Copy, Paste, Undo dan sejenisnya. Tampilan Toolbar

dapat dilihat pada gambar 2.4.

Gambar 2.4Toolbar Microsoft Visual Basic 6.0

4. Toolbox, merupakan kotak perangkat yang berisi kumpulan tombol objek atau kontrol untuk mengatur desain dari aplikasi yang akan di buat. Pada kondisi default, toolbox menampilkan tabulasi general dengan 21 tombol kontrol yang berada pada sebelah kiri layar Visual Basic. Tampilan

Toolbox dapat dilihat pada gambar 2.5.

5. Form Window, merupakan jendela desain atau daerah kerja utama dari pembuatan program atau tempat perancangan aplikasi (Container). Pada daerah form inilah meletakkan atau menggambarkan objek interaktif seperti misalnya tombol-tombol, gambar, teks, garis, tabel, combo,

chekbox dan tool lainnya. Sehingga objek yang berada pada form tersebut akan ditampilkan pada layar Windows jika program dijalankan. Form

tersebut akan menjadi latar belakang atau tempat (Container) dari objek dari sebuah program yang dijalankan. Tampilan Form Window dapat dilihat pada gambar 2.6.

Gambar 2.6Form Window Microsoft Visual Basic 6.0

6. Project Explorer, merupakan suatu kumpulan module atau merupakan program dari aplikasi itu sendiri yang memiliki banyak file seperti file Form, Modul, Class dan yang lainnya. Dalam Visual Basic, file project

disimpan dengan nama file berakhiran .VBP, dimana file ini berfungsi untuk menyimpan seluruh komponen program. Tampilan Project Explorer

Gambar 2.7Project Explorer

7. Property Window, merupakan jendela yang berisi semua informasi tentang suatu objek yang terdapat pada Visual Basic dan digunakan untuk menampung nama properti suatu kontrol. Properti merupakan suatu sifat dari objek dimana sebuah objek memiliki properti warna, ukuran, posisi, lebar, jenis, tipe dan sifat yang lainnya. Tampilan Property Window dapat dilihat pada gambar 2.8.

8. Form Layout Window, merupakan sebuah jendela yang digunakan untuk mengatur posisi form pada saat program dijalankan. Pada saat kita mengarahkan pointer mouse ke bagian form, maka printer mouse akan berubah menjadi anak panah empat arah (printer mengatur posisi). Untuk memindah posisi form pada layar monitor dapat kita lakukan proses drag and drop (menggeser mouse). Tampilan Form Layout Window dapat dilihat pada gambar 2.9.

Gambar 2.9Form Layout View

9. Code Window, merupakan sebuah jendela yang digunakan untuk menuliskan kode program dari kontrol yang kita pasang pada jendela form

dengan cara memilih terlebih dahulu kontrol pada kotak objek. Dengan kata lain berfungsi untuk penulisan dari instruksi-instruksi program untuk pembuatan program. Tampilan Code Window dapat dilihat pada gambar 2.10.

Gambar 2.10Jendela Kode Program

10. Immediate Window, merupakan sebuah jendela yang digunakan untuk mencoba beberapa perintah dengan mengetikkan baris program dan kita dapat secara langsung melihat hasilnya. Hal tersebut biasa dilakukan dan sangat membantu proses pengujian suatu perintah sebelum dipasang di dalam program. Tampilan jendela Immediate dapat dilihat pada gambar 2.11

Gambar 2.11Immediate Window

Bahasa pemrograman Visual Basic 6.0 memiliki beberapa konsep dasar diantaranya :

1. Event, merupakan suatu kejadian yang akan diterima oleh suatu objek.

Event yang diterima oleh objek berfungsi untuk menjalankan kode program yang ada di dalam objek tersebut.

2. Method, merupakan suatu kumpulan perintah yang memiliki kegunaan yang hampir sama dengan suatu fungsi atau prosedur, tetapi perintah- perintah tersebut sudah disediakan dalam suatu objek. Suatu method dapat dipanggil dengan cara menyebutkan nama objek dan diikuti dengan tanda titik dan nama metodenya. Method umumnya digunakan untuk menjalankan perintah khusus pada suatu objek tertentu.

3. Module, hampir sama fungsinya dengan form, tetapi module tidak berisi objek dan bentuk standar, module berisi kode program atau prosedur yang dapat digunakan oleh program aplikasi. Kita dapat menambahkan suatu

module ke dalam program aplikasi dengan menggunakan perintah Project- Add Module, dan kemudian mengisinya dengan suatu kode program yang akan digunakan oleh aplikasi tersebut.

Dokumen terkait